THE BRIEF
The brief was to create a high-end custom home that responded to significant flood planning constraints while capturing the site's exceptional outlook. The owners wanted a spacious family residence that would remain comfortable year-round, provide strong indoor-outdoor connections and take full advantage of the riverfront setting.
DESIGN RESPONSE
Extensive pre-lodgement planning and architectural drafting were undertaken to address flood risk and establish appropriate floor levels and site planning controls. Sustainable design principles were incorporated through careful solar orientation, passive climate design and natural light optimisation to improve year-round comfort and reduce energy demand. Open-plan living areas, generous entertaining spaces and large glazing were positioned to maximise river and Blue Mountains views while responding to the Western Sydney climate.
PROJECT OUTCOME
Nepean House demonstrates how custom home design can successfully respond to complex flood-affected sites without compromising lifestyle, architectural quality or sustainability. The completed residence delivers flood resilience, strong solar performance, expansive family living and seamless indoor-outdoor entertaining while maintaining a close connection to its unique riverfront location. The result is a climate-responsive luxury home that remains both practical and visually striking within the Penrith landscape.
